CC攻击(Challenge Collapsar Attack)与CDN(内容分发网络,Content Delivery Network)是网络安全与网站性能优化领域的两个重要概念。它们之间存在一定的关联,特别是在防御网络攻击方面。
CC攻击简介
CC攻击是一种常见的网络攻击方式,主要目标是消耗网站的资源,使其无法正常服务于合法用户。攻击者通过大量生成请求(这些请求通常模仿正常用户的行为)来占用服务器资源,导致服务器响应速度变慢甚至崩溃。CC攻击的特点是请求量大、频率高,但单个请求可能看起来与正常请求无异,这使得CC攻击难以被简单的流量分析工具检测出来。
CDN简介
CDN是一种通过在多地部署节点缓存内容,来加速用户获取数据的技术。它通过将内容分发到靠近用户的节点,减少数据的传输距离和时间,从而加快内容加载速度并提高网站性能。CDN不仅能够加速静态内容的分发,还可以通过负载均衡等技术优化动态内容的访问效率。
CC攻击与CDN的关联
CDN可以作为一种有效的防御CC攻击的手段。通过以下方式,CDN能够减轻或阻止CC攻击的影响:
- 分散攻击流量:CDN通过其全球分布的节点分散攻击流量,减轻任何单一服务器的负载压力。
- 缓存静态资源:CDN可以缓存网站的静态资源,即使在受到CC攻击时,也能快速从缓存中提供内容,减少对源服务器的请求。
- 智能流量分析:许多CDN提供商提供了高级的流量分析和管理工具,可以识别并过滤掉异常流量,从而防御CC攻击。
- 限速与挑战:CDN可以对请求进行限速,或者向疑似非法请求发送验证码等挑战,以区分正常用户和攻击者。
然而,虽然CDN可以提供基本的防御,但对于更复杂的CC攻击,可能需要结合其他安全措施,如Web应用防火墙(WAF)、行为分析、IP黑名单等,才能更有效地保护网站不受攻击。
原创文章,作者:速盾网络,如若转载,请注明出处:https://www.sudun.com/news/484.html